Day 1 – Arrive Tokyo
Welcome to Japan! Upon arrival in Tokyo, complete immigration formalities and meet your representative. Transfer to your hotel and relax after your journey.
In the evening, you can explore nearby streets, convenience stores, or simply unwind at the hotel.
Overnight in Tokyo.
DAY 2 – Tokyo City Tour
After breakfast, begin your guided city tour of Tokyo. Visit the serene Meiji Shrine, photo stop at the iconic Tokyo Skytree, and witness the world-famous Shibuya Crossing. Explore vibrant neighborhoods and enjoy the blend of traditional and modern Tokyo.
Overnight in Tokyo.
DAY 3 – Mt. Fuji & Hakone Adventure
Drive towards Mt. Fuji, Japan’s most celebrated mountain. Weather permitting, ascend to the 5th Station for breathtaking views. Continue to Hakone, where you visit Owakudani Valley and enjoy a scenic ride on the Hakone Ropeway.
Overnight in Tokyo.
DAY 4 – Tokyo → Osaka (Bullet Train) + Osaka City Tour
Experience the thrill of Japan’s Shinkansen bullet train as you travel to Osaka. On arrival, enjoy a photo stop at Osaka Castle and later explore the colorful streets of Dotonbori, famous for its neon lights and food culture.
Overnight in Osaka.
DAY 5 – Kyoto & Nara Highlights
Today, explore Japan’s cultural heart. Visit Kyoto’s iconic Fushimi Inari Shrine with its endless red torii gates and the stunning Kinkaku-ji (Golden Pavilion). Continue to Nara to visit Todaiji Temple and see the friendly Nara deer.
Overnight in Osaka.
DAY 6 – Osaka → Hiroshima → Miyajima Island
Take the bullet train to Hiroshima. Visit the moving Peace Memorial Park & Museum, then take a ferry to Miyajima Island, known for its floating torii gate and scenic beauty.
Overnight in Hiroshima.
DAY 7 – Hiroshima → Kobe
Travel to Kobe, known for its elegant port and stunning waterfront. Visit Kobe Harborland, explore Meriken Park, or simply enjoy the city’s relaxed ambience.
Overnight in Kobe.

Frequently Asked Questions
1. What type of traveller enjoys Japan the most?
Japan suits every type of traveller—culture lovers, adventure seekers, food explorers, families, and honeymooners. Its blend of tradition and modernity ensures a unique experience tailored to everyone.
2. Is Japan easy to explore for first-time visitors?
Yes! Japan’s transportation system is one of the best in the world. Bullet trains, subway lines, and well-marked signboards make it extremely easy, even for first-timers.

4. Are Japan’s attractions suitable for children and senior travellers?
Absolutely. Japan is incredibly safe, clean, and accessible. Theme parks like DisneySea and Universal Studios, along with gentle cultural experiences, make it perfect for families and seniors.
5. Can I travel Japan without knowing Japanese?
Yes. English is widely understood in transport hubs, hotels, and restaurants. Plus, Japan’s high-tech navigation apps and friendly locals make travelling very comfortable.
